在巴西、澳大利亚、新加坡、犹他州和路易斯安那州分发的 App 所适用的年龄要求

今天,我们将针对一些可用于开发者的工具提供最新信息,这些工具旨在帮助开发者履行美国本土 (包括犹他州和路易斯安那州) 以及巴西、澳大利亚、新加坡等地区即将生效的法律所规定的年龄保证义务。Declared Age Range API 的更新现已推出 Beta 版,以供测试。

巴西

在巴西分发 App 的开发者可以使用更新后的 Declared Age Range API 获取用户的年龄类别。对于巴西用户,当用户本人或者家长或监护人 (在适用的情况下) 同意与你分享其年龄类别时,相应信息将被分享。此外,这个 API 还会返回来自用户设备的信号,指明年龄保证的方式。

澳大利亚、新加坡和巴西年龄分级为 18+ 的 App

自 2026 年 2 月 24 日起,Apple 将阻止澳大利亚、巴西和新加坡的用户下载年龄分级为 18+ 的 App,除非他们已通过合理方法确认为成年人。App Store 会自动执行这项确认。尽管如此,开发者或许仍需履行独立的法律义务,自行确认用户是否为成年人。为了协助开发者履行这项义务,Declared Age Range API (适用于 iOS、iPadOS 和 macOS) 为开发者提供了有关用户年龄的有用信号。

对于在巴西分发 App 的开发者,如果你通过年龄分级调查问卷将 App 标识为包含战利品箱,则你的 App 在巴西店面上的年龄分级将更新为 18+。

犹他州和路易斯安那州

自 2026 年 5 月 6 日 (犹他州) 和 2026 年 7 月 1 日 (路易斯安那州) 起,对于拥有新 Apple 账户的用户,当开发者的 App 通过 Declared Age Range API 请求获取这些用户的年龄类别时,相应信息将与 App 共享。我们之前发布的各款工具已得到扩展,旨在帮助开发者履行路易斯安那州和犹他州的合规义务,具体包括:

Declared Age Range API (英文)

PermissionKit 下的 Significant Change API (英文)

StoreKit 中的全新年龄分级属性类型 (英文)

App Store 服务器通知 (英文)

现在可通过 Declared Age Range API 获取新的信号,包括用户是否受年龄相关监管要求的约束,以及用户是否必须分享自己的年龄段。这个 API 还会提示你,对于涉及儿童的重大 App 更新,是否需要获得家长或监护人的许可。

开发者可以使用 Declared Age Range API,通过目前已推出 Beta 版的 Significant Update Action 向这些州的成年人推送重要更新通知。发布重要更新时,开发者必须遵循《人机界面指南》,并为用户提供有意义的更新描述。

年龄保证框架问答 (英文)

为你的 App 和游戏设计安全且适龄的体验